Understanding the Scope of Kitchen Remodeling

When embarking on kitchen remodeling, it is important to understand the extensive nature of such projects. Kitchen renovation typically involves a series of interconnected tasks, each requiring careful planning and execution.

The scope can range from minor updates, like replacing cabinet doors and countertops, to full-scale renovations that might include altering the layout, updating electrical and plumbing systems, and installing new appliances. As you consider whether to tackle a DIY kitchen remodeling project or hire professionals, recognize that each aspect of the process, from demolition to the final touches, presents its own set of challenges.

For instance, you may need to address structural elements, guarantee compliance with local building codes, and manage waste disposal efficiently. Properly understanding the full scope of these elements helps in making an informed decision about your approach.

In terms of labor and expertise involved, kitchen remodeling demands a wide range of skills and careful coordination among different trades. Some tasks you might overlook initially include installing proper ventilation systems to meet safety standards, achieving seamless integration of electrical outlets and lighting fixtures, and dealing with potential plumbing realignments to accommodate new sinks or dishwashers.

For a DIY kitchen remodeling enthusiast, these tasks can become daunting without prior experience and technical knowledge. Moreover, accurately estimating the time required for each phase and synchronizing work schedules can be quite labor-intensive.

Thus, if you wish to guarantee a seamless renovation process, understanding when the expertise of an experienced professional is indispensable could save you significant amounts of stress, unexpected costs, and time in the long run.

The unforeseen elements of kitchen renovations further complicate the decision-making process. Hidden issues such as outdated wiring, mold behind walls, or unexpected ventilation needs can surface during demolition.

These unforeseen challenges often require specialized intervention and can lead to unplanned expenses. By identifying these potential snags early in the planning phase, you can better assess whether DIY kitchen remodeling suits your capabilities or if professional intervention is warranted.

 

The Pros and Cons of DIY Kitchen Remodeling

Considering a DIY kitchen remodeling project, you should weigh several factors meticulously. One of the immediate advantages often underscored is the potential cost savings. By eliminating labor fees, there's an opportunity to stretch your kitchen remodel budget further, possibly allowing you to invest in higher-end materials or added features.

DIY projects often offer a sense of personal satisfaction and accomplishment upon seeing the fruits of your hard work. The hands-on experience gained while learning new skills can be both enriching and empowering.

Simple yet impactful tasks, such as painting kitchen cabinets, offer a relatively low-risk way to begin your DIY journey. Moreover, the flexibility to work at your own pace, on your schedule, can be particularly appealing, especially if you relish the process of home improvements.

However, alongside these benefits, embarking on a DIY kitchen remodeling venture comes with its set of challenges and potential drawbacks. One significant consideration is the steep learning curve involved.

Lack of expertise can turn even seemingly straightforward tasks into time-consuming undertakings. Without the nuanced knowledge and experience of professionals, you might encounter difficulties in achieving the high-quality finish you envision.

Moreover, the time commitment should not be underestimated. Balancing a full kitchen remodel with daily responsibilities and work commitments can lead to prolonged projects that impact your daily life significantly.

It's also important to acknowledge the risk of hidden costs. Unplanned expenditures can arise from mistakes, improper installations, or the need for specialized tools which you might not already own. Therefore, understanding the limits of your expertise and the potential for overextending your kitchen remodel budget is fundamental.

Furthermore, the complexity of kitchen remodeling projects can present challenges that may not be immediately apparent. Expertise in multiple trades, such as carpentry, electrical work, and plumbing, is often required to achieve a seamless result.

For instance, relocating a sink or dishwasher involves precise plumbing realignments which, if done incorrectly, could result in leaks or water damage. Similarly, electrical updates may necessitate meeting stringent local codes to guarantee safety, something that professionals navigate with ease but can be daunting for a DIYer.

Thus, while the allure of DIY kitchen remodeling, with its promises of cost savings and personal growth, is strong, the potential pitfalls highlight the value a professional touch can bring to your project. Striking a balance between what you can realistically achieve on your own and where professional intervention becomes fundamental will ultimately lead to the most satisfying and stress-free remodeling experience.

 

Why Consider Professional Kitchen Remodeling

When opting for a professional service, you are not just paying for labor; you are investing in years of experience, specialized knowledge, and the ability to foresee and navigate potential issues. For instance, professional remodelers are adept at managing complex tasks that might be overwhelming for a DIY enthusiast.

They possess a keen eye for detail and precision, ensuring that every element, whether it’s a custom countertop or an intricate backsplash, aligns perfectly with the overall design vision and functionality. Additionally, professionals stay updated with the latest trends and materials in the industry, offering you invaluable kitchen remodeling advice tailored to your personal tastes and practical needs.

This expertise translates into higher-quality workmanship that elevates the aesthetics and usability of your kitchen, often achieving results that exceed homeowner expectations.

One of the most compelling reasons to choose professional kitchen remodeling is the significant time savings associated with outsourcing this demanding project. Coordinating various trades such as electricians, plumbers, and carpenters can be an overwhelming and time-consuming task if undertaken alone.

Professionals streamline this process through well-established networks and efficient project management skills, minimizing downtime and ensuring that each phase of the renovation proceeds smoothly and on schedule. This allows you to avoid the disruptions that long-drawn-out projects can cause in your daily life, granting you peace of mind and the luxury of simply enjoying the progress.

Furthermore, professional remodelers are well-equipped to handle unexpected challenges that could derail a DIY project. Should unforeseen issues like water damage or outdated wiring arise, having a skilled team on hand means that solutions can be swiftly and effectively implemented, avoiding potentially costly delays and further damage.

While the kitchen remodeling cost may initially seem higher when engaging professionals, it is important to consider the long-term value that this investment brings to your home. High-quality craftsmanship often translates into durability and lower maintenance requirements, preserving your kitchen’s pristine condition for years to come.

This resilience can be especially advantageous if you ever decide to sell your home, as professionally remodeled kitchens are a highly attractive feature for prospective buyers, often justifying a higher selling price. Moreover, experts are able to maximize your budget by sourcing premium materials and fixtures at competitive prices, ensuring that you receive the best possible value for your investment.
